Washington's weather patterns necessitate robust plumbing. Consistent rainfall can lead to foundation issues and basement flooding, while winter's freezing temperatures pose a risk of burst pipes, particularly in older homes common in Seattle and Tacoma. Does insurance cover emergency plumbing in Washington?

Insurance coverage for emergency plumbing in Washington varies by policy. Most homeowners policies cover sudden and accidental damage, such as from burst pipes. However, coverage for maintenance-related issues or wear and tear is typically excluded. It's best to review your policy details.
